AUSTIN, Texas, Oct. 22 -- Gov. Greg Abbott, R-Texas, issued the following news release on Oct. 21:
Governor Greg Abbott and the Texas Education Agency (TEA) today announced the establishment of the Supplementary Special Education Services (SSES) program to connect eligible students with severe cognitive disabilities with additional support for the critical services they require.
